Lòugǎn Nèixiāo Pills

Lòugǎn Nèixiāo Pills,For abscesses and boils on the back, and ulcers or hemorrhoids that have developed fistulas.

Formulas Name : Lòugǎn Nèixiāo Pills

Chinese Name : 漏管内消丸

Drug Formulation

Hedgehog skin (roasted) 5 qian, genuine elephant skin 5 qian, licorice nodes (mixed with softshell turtle blood, stir-fried until dry) 1 liang,small red beans (sun-dried) 2 liang, red peony root (roasted) 1 liang, pine pollen (baked) 1 liang, roasted turtle shell slices 2 qian, elephant ivory shavings (sun-dried) 2 liang, yellow gelatin (roasted with clam powder) 2 liang, honeysuckle (roasted) 7 qian.

Source

From *Extraordinary Formulas Beyond Surgical Prescriptions*, Volume 2.

Processing

Grind the above ingredients into a fine powder. Use ground Job’s tears to make a paste, then boil it with water to form a paste for making pills the size of a tung tree seed.

Benefits

For abscesses and boils on the back, and ulcers or hemorrhoids that have developed fistulas.

Instructions for Use

Take 1.5 qian per dose, washed down with boiling water.
